logo

Output ff8676d6c91108f34c788ae602059ceb79c6319da8cd7465008486e1ff9ff814:1

value
28060611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 870125625bac6f7728c73f59533b8308b86d605a OP_EQUAL
address
3DzrX4vuX24oWRWasE4N1Jahgo2GethywG
transaction
ff8676d6c91108f34c788ae602059ceb79c6319da8cd7465008486e1ff9ff814